NASA's $30M Mission to Boost Swift Observatory's Orbit

Story summary
  • NASA plans to rescue Neil Gehrels Swift Observatory by boosting its orbit by the end of 2026.
  • Arizona-based Katalyst Space Technologies will launch a robotic spacecraft to boost the Swift's altitude, marking a first for a commercial spacecraft to assist a government satellite.
  • The Pegasus XL rocket will be dropped from a modified L-1011 aircraft at 39,000 feet.
  • The mission costs about $30 million, far less than Swift's $500 million.
